Synopsis
Müller describes Ovid's Metamorphoses, Golding's translation of which (1603) was one of Shakespeare's sources, as an encyclopedia of the Greek myths, its dramatic central theme being the transformation of human beings into animals, plants, stones---either as a punishment or out of a need to escape.
